Credit scores are determined by a few key aspects but the level of debt one has seems to play into this idea the most. It's clear that these problems can be seen in great amounts today and I'm sure people wonder what can be done in order to make these scores better. There are a couple of paths which exist and it seems like they will work in order to make such payments easier on people. Accounts collection services may just have cited a new way to help this matter.
Accounts collection servicesare utilized in order to attain amounts which have to be paid off. Debts are rarely left unattended, which means that they have to be secured in a timely fashion. This is the name of the game of agencies along the lines of Rapid Recovery because of just how imperative these amounts in question can prove themselves to be. As said before, these debts can play into credit scores, but how exactly is this going to change, whether it is for better or worse?
The New York Times recently posted an article, which went into detail about the new workings of VantageScores Solutions. The system will generate your credit score, yes, but the defining feature of this is that it will not bring the paid amounts you made into the picture. These could include a number of different categories, hospital bills being one such example. These scores have to go through generation processes and I think that this could have quite a few outcomes for individuals who use it.
You have to consider both the good and the bad that can come from this alteration. On one hand, this system will be great when it comes to treating those who made such payments well. After all, not everyone is going to actively avoid the amounts they owe and will work in order to pay them off, meaning that they are cut just the smallest amount of slack. However, will this system work in order to take care of the debt problem that is seen overall?
It seems like debt is constantly becoming a problem in the United States and you may wonder if this system, endorsed by some accounts collection services, will be able to help the matter. I think that it has the potential to appeal to people who owe such amounts, allowing them to actively pursue what they owe. I will say, though, that it won't help everyone who owes these amounts. It seems too early to say, as we will have to see what happens in time.
